Doo.Ri

NEW YORK, June 4, 2009
By Laird Borrelli-Persson
"Resort is about the customer," said Doo-Ri Chung, sitting in her bright white studio next to a rack of gray and blue dresses that are sure to please her fans. Chung played it safe (though no doubt smart) with signature jerseys that came twisted and pleated for Resort, but she also added a sense of play to the collection, working a sequin print into a sexy float-top spaghetti-strap dress. "I tried to keep the clothes simple, but with enough experiment and design so that they don't look like anyone else's," Chung explained. Overall, mission accomplished.
